EDUCATION NEWS

  • Cannon School’s Brainy Yaks robotics team earned a spot in the top 100 at the world championship from over 32,000 teams, showing their skill and dedication. The team will now prepare for more challenges while representing their school.  Independent Tribune

GOVERNMENT NEWS

  • On Friday morning in downtown Concord, Chief Deputy Tessa Burchett received the Robert J. Eury Award during the Law Enforcement Day and Peace Officers Memorial where community members and local leaders honored her compassionate leadership—she was praised by Sheriff Van Shaw and other colleagues for her professionalism, integrity, and commitment to public service.  Cabarrus County Government
